•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

ESC-toets uitschakelen/blokkeren

Status
Niet open voor verdere reacties.

Bert2010

Gebruiker
Lid geworden
18 aug 2010
Berichten
61
Beste allemaal,
ik werk met excel 2010 en ben zo ver dat alle balken via een macro zichtbaar/onzichtbaar zijn.
Echter als ze onzichtbaar zijn en ik druk op de ESC-toets worden ze weer zichtbaar, ze moeten onzichtbaar blijven zodat geen bewerkingen kunnen worden uitgevoerd.
Ik heb op forums en internet gezocht naar een routine, deze werken echter niet.
Bestaan hiervoor codes?
 
Laatst bewerkt:
Ik neem aan dat je bedoelt dat men tijdens het runnen van de macro op Esc drukt zodat de gegevens zichtbaar worden.

Dit kan je ondervangen dmv
Code:
Application.EnableCancelKey = xlDisabled

Wees wel heel voorzichtig met het gebruik hiervan.
Bij een foutmelding zal de code namelijk niet stoppen!

Met vriendelijke groet,


Roncancio
 
Nogmaals ESC-toets en balken zichtbaar maken.

Ik ben waarschijnlijk in mijn vorige vraag niet duidelijk geweest.
Hopelijk wordt door de bijlage mijn vraag duidelijk.
 

Bijlagen

Zet onderstaande code in ThisWorkbook

Code:
Private Sub Workbook_BeforeClose(Cancel As Boolean)
Application.OnKey "{ESC}"
End Sub

Private Sub Workbook_Open()
Onzichtbaar_maken_Toolbars
Application.OnKey "{ESC}", ""
End Sub

Bij het openen van het bestand wordt de ESC uitgeschakeld en bij het sluiten van het bestand weer ingeschakeld.

Met vriendelijke groet,


Roncancio
 
Roncancio, bedankt voor je snelle reactie, je hebt me geweldig geholpen.
Bedankt!
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an